General Description
QSFP28 passive copper cable assembly inoratidzira masere akasiyana emhangura pairi, ichipa mana nzira dzekufambisa data nekukurumidza kusvika ku28Gbps pachiteshi, uye inosangana ne100G Ethernet, 25G Ethernet uye InfiniBand Enhanced Data Rate (EDR) zvinodiwa. kubva ku26AWG kuburikidza ne30AWG-iyi 100G copper cable musangano inoratidzira kurasikirwa kwekuisa pasi uye kuderera kwekutaura kwemuchinjikwa.
Yakagadzirirwa maapplication ari munzvimbo yedata, network uye misika yekufonera inoda kukurumidza, yakavimbika tambo kusangana, ichi chinotevera chigadzirwa chigadzirwa chinogovana zvakafanana mating interface neQSFP + fomu factor, zvichiita kuti idzokere kumashure ienderane neiyo iripo QSFP ports.QSFP28 inogona kushandiswa yazvino 10G uye 14G maapplication ane yakakura chiratidzo chekuvimbika margin.
Features uye Benefits
◊ Inoenderana neIEEE 802.3bj, IEEE 802.3by uye InfiniBand EDR
◊ Inotsigira aggregate data mitengo ye100Gbps
◊ Kuvaka kwakakwenenzverwa kudzikisa kurasikirwa kwekupinza uye kutaura
◊ Kumashure kunoenderana nearipo QSFP + majoini nemakeji
◊ Dhonza-ku-kusunungura siraidhi latch dhizaini
◊ 26AWG kuburikidza ne30AWG tambo
◊ Yakatwasuka uye gadzira magadzirirwo egungano aripo
◊ Yakagadzirirwa tambo yakarukwa kumisa miganho EMI mwaranzi
◊ Customizable EEPROM mepu yetambo siginicha
◊ RoHS inoenderana
